Output 04816f26dfa6a159c87954afb2509f6bf597401b68e7ef6e2dd0fe2bd84477c9:1

value
12534324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7ececa56baae89b4c40aa764335c168b100ce4d OP_EQUAL
address
MPD4uG8f6NWwx8TFWYgf4WXi6ARCam3AYG
transaction
04816f26dfa6a159c87954afb2509f6bf597401b68e7ef6e2dd0fe2bd84477c9
spent
true